ERLIN2 (HGNC:1356): (ER lipid raft associated 2) This gene encodes a member of the SPFH domain-containing family of lipid raft-associated proteins. The encoded protein is localized to lipid rafts of the endoplasmic reticulum and plays a critical role in inositol 1,4,5-trisphosphate (IP3) signaling by mediating ER-associated degradation of activated IP3 receptors. Mutations in this gene are a cause of spastic paraplegia-18 (SPG18). Alternatively spliced transcript variants encoding multiple isoforms have been observed for this gene. Pathogenic, criteria provided, single submitter | clinical testing | Invitae | Apr 09, 2023 | This variant is not present in population databases (gnomAD no frequency). This sequence change creates a premature translational stop signal (p.Ser61Valfs*10) in the ERLIN2 gene. It is expected to result in an absent or disrupted protein product. Loss-of-function variants in ERLIN2 are known to be pathogenic (PMID: 21330303, 23109145, 24482476, 27824013). This variant has not been reported in the literature in individuals affected with ERLIN2-related conditions. For these reasons, this variant has been classified as Pathogenic. - |
